Wikipedia offers by way of explanation that the chain had been named Z-Teca up until 1998, when trademark infringement lawsuits by Z'Tejas Southwestern Grill and Azteca prompted them to pick some safer name. Z-Teca, meanwhile, was the name they picked after their original name of Zuma was also hit with a trademark infringement suit. How Qdoba made the cut I don't know but I'm guessing they picked anything that nobody had registered first.
